Abstract
A PAPER on “The Mineral Resources of the British Empire with regard to the Production of the Non-Ferrous Industrial Metals,” by Dr. C. Gilbert Cullis, professor of economic mineralogy in the Imperial College of Science and Technology, was read before the Society of Engineers on December 11.
